CVE-2002-1360: Multiple SSH2 servers and clients do not properly handle strings with null characters in them when the stri...

Multiple SSH2 servers and clients do not properly handle strings with null characters in them when the string length is specified by a length field, which could allow remote attackers to cause a denial of service or possibly execute arbitrary code due to interactions with the use of null-terminated strings as implemented using languages such as C, as demonstrated by the SSHredder SSH protocol test suite.

This is an old SSH2 parsing flaw where some clients and servers mishandled text containing embedded null characters. A remote party could crash affected software and, in some implementations, might trigger code execution. The provided bundle does not identify specific affected products, versions, patches, or active exploitation. Exposure is most plausible in obsolete SSH2 clients or servers from the 2002 era, especially internet-facing administration services. The bundle only says multiple implementations were affected and lists no vendor, product, version, or CPE details. Treat this as a legacy technology risk rather than a confirmed current campaign. The priority is ensuring no unsupported SSH2 implementations remain on critical or exposed systems, because SSH commonly protects privileged administration paths. Mitigation focus: Inventory SSH clients and servers, especially legacy or unsupported implementations.; Check vendor advisories for affected versions and official fixes.; Upgrade or replace obsolete SSH2 software where vendor support is unavailable..
